The Rise of Foldable Mobility Scooters: A Comprehensive Guide
As individuals age or experience mobility obstacles, the mission for self-reliance typically leads them to check out mobility services. Foldable mobility scooters have gained appeal as an efficient service, using ease of use, portability, and comfort for people needing support in getting around. This article explores the functions, benefits, and factors to consider surrounding foldable mobility scooters, providing valuable insights for possible users and caretakers alike.
Comprehending Foldable Mobility Scooters
Foldable Scooter Mobility mobility scooters are compact, lightweight, and user-friendly gadgets created to assist people with mobility issues. Unlike standard mobility scooters, which can be bulky and hard to transfer, these foldable models easily collapse into workable sizes for easy storage or transport in vehicles.

The growing popularity of foldable mobility scooters can be attributed to several advantages. Below are some benefits often highlighted by users:
Portability: Their lightweight and foldable nature makes them easy to carry in automobiles, on public transport, or throughout travel.Space-Efficient: Since they can be folded, these scooters need less storage space compared to conventional designs, making them ideal for people living in smaller sized homes or apartments.User-Friendly: Most designs are designed with simpleness in mind, permitting users to run the scooters easily.Affordable: Compared to powered wheelchairs, foldable scooters can be more budget friendly while offering similar mobility benefits.Versatile Use: Suitable for both indoor and outside use, they can navigate tight spaces within a home, as well as maneuver through parks and shopping locations.Factors to Consider When Choosing a Foldable Mobility Scooter
